+//
+// This looks strange, but it's really quite simple: We want a point that's
+// more than half-way to the next grid point to snap there while conversely we
+// want a point that's less than half-way to to the next grid point then snap
+// to the one before it. So we add half of the grid spacing to the point, then
+// divide by it so that we can remove the fractional part, then multiply it
+// back to get back to the correct answer.
+//
+Point DrawingView::SnapPointToGrid(Point point)
+{
+       point += Global::gridSpacing / 2.0;             // *This* adds to Z!!!
+       point /= Global::gridSpacing;
+       point.x = floor(point.x);//need to fix this for negative numbers...
+       point.y = floor(point.y);
+       point.z = 0;                                    // Make *sure* Z doesn't go anywhere!!!
+       point *= Global::gridSpacing;
+       return point;
+}
